<pre style='margin:0'>
Herby Gillot (herbygillot) pushed a commit to branch master
in repository macports-ports.

</pre>
<p><a href="https://github.com/macports/macports-ports/commit/ef728e363ec0dd7422f64654a5006a775ac82c4d">https://github.com/macports/macports-ports/commit/ef728e363ec0dd7422f64654a5006a775ac82c4d</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it ef728e363ec0dd7422f64654a5006a775ac82c4d
</span>Author: Sergey Fedorov <barracuda@macos-powerpc.org>
AuthorDate: Fri Sep 13 15:24:57 2024 +0800

<span style='display:block; white-space:pre;color:#404040;'>    rsgain: use libfmt9, and via a variant, revbump
</span>---
 audio/rsgain/Portfile | 20 +++++++++++---------
 1 file changed, 11 insertions(+), 9 deletions(-)

<span style='display:block; white-space:pre;color:#808080;'>diff --git a/audio/rsgain/Portfile b/audio/rsgain/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 773f5c13615..ce279305118 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/audio/rsgain/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/audio/rsgain/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-6,7 +6,7 @@ PortGroup                       github 1.0
</span> PortGroup                       cmake 1.1
 
 github.setup                    complexlogic rsgain 3.5.2 v
<span style='display:block; white-space:pre;background:#ffe0e0;'>-revision                        0
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ision                        1
</span> 
 categories                      audio
 platforms                       {darwin all}
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-31,23 +31,25 @@ checksums                       rmd160  c4152e8b4d7534b82e0c1c15821bbf1241616f90
</span>                                 sha256  4f701521fd270b60f536a12aeb64e09bb87f24c30d576231d2fda3b6cc8c697e \
                                 size    51204
 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-set libfmt_version              11
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span> depends_build-append            path:bin/pkg-config:pkgconfig
 
 depends_lib                     port:libebur128 \
                                 port:taglib \
                                 port:ffmpeg \
<span style='display:block; white-space:pre;background:#ffe0e0;'>-                                port:inih \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-                                port:libfmt${libfmt_version}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+                                port:inih
</span> 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-configure.pkg_config_path       ${prefix}/lib/libfmt${libfmt_version}/pkgconfig
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+configure.args-append           -DUSE_STD_FORMAT=ON
</span> 
 compiler.cxx_standard           2020
 
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# Use libfmt9 until this is fixed:
</span> # https://github.com/complexlogic/rsgain/issues/126
<span style='display:block; white-space:pre;background:#ffe0e0;'>-if {${configure.cxx_stdlib} ne "libc++"}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-    depends_lib-delete          port:libfmt${libfmt_version}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+variant fmt description "Build with libfmt" {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    set libfmt_version          9
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    depends_lib-append          port:libfmt${libfmt_version}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    configure.pkg_config_path   ${prefix}/lib/libfmt${libfmt_version}/pkgconfig
</span> 
<span style='display:block; white-space:pre;background:#ffe0e0;'>-    configure.args-append       -DUSE_STD_FORMAT=ON
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+    configure.args-replace      -DUSE_STD_FORMAT=ON -DUSE_STD_FORMAT=OFF
</span> }
</pre><pre style='margin:0'>

</pre>